A deep breathing exercise to assist you sleep, Breathing from your tummy rather than your chest can activate the relaxation action and lower your heart rate, blood pressure, and tension levels to help you drift off to sleep. Put down in bed and close your eyes. Put one hand on your chest and the other on your stomach.

The hand on your stomach ought to rise. The hand on your chest should move very little. Breathe out through your mouth, pressing out as much air as you can while contracting your stomach muscles. The hand on your stomach ought to relocate as you breathe out, but your other hand ought to move very bit.

Breathe in, then breathe out slowly while saying or thinking the word, "Ahhh." Take another breath and repeat. If you find it difficult to fall back asleep, attempt a relaxation technique such as visualization, progressive muscle relaxation, or meditation, which can be done without even rising.

If you've been awake for more than 15 minutes, rise and do a quiet, non-stimulating activity, such as reading a book. Keep the lights dim and avoid screens so as not to cue your body that it's time to awaken. If you wake during the night feeling anxious about something, make a short note of it on paper and delay worrying about it up until the next day when it will be much easier to fix.

Try getting day-to-day sunlight exposure or if this is not useful purchase an artificial brilliant light gadget or bulbs. Daily sunshine or artificial bright light can enhance sleep quality and duration, especially if you have severe sleep problems or sleeping disorders. Direct exposure to light throughout the day is useful, but nighttime light direct exposure has the opposite impact (, ).

Caffeine has various benefits and is taken in by 90% of the U.S. population (,,,, ). A single dosage can improve focus, energy, and sports efficiency (,, ). When consumed late in the day, caffeine stimulates your nervous system and may stop your body from naturally unwinding at night.

Caffeine can remain elevated in your blood for 68 hours. Drinking large quantities of coffee after 34 p. m. is not advised, specifically if you're sensitive to caffeine or have difficulty sleeping (, ). If you do crave a cup of coffee in the late afternoon or night, stick to decaffeinated coffee.

Nevertheless, some studies show that those who are utilized to taking regular daytime naps don't experience poor sleep quality or interrupted sleep in the evening. If you take routine daytime naps and sleep well, you should not worry. The results of taking a snooze depend on the person (,, ). Long daytime naps might hinder sleep quality.

If you fight with sleep, try to get in the practice of awakening and going to bed at similar times. After several weeks, you might not even need an alarm. Attempt to get into a routine sleep/wake cycle specifically on the weekends. If possible, try to wake up naturally at a similar time every day.

Melatonin supplements are an incredibly popular sleep help. Frequently used to treat sleeping disorders, melatonin might be among the most convenient methods to go to sleep much faster (, ). In one research study, taking 2 mg of melatonin before bed enhanced sleep quality and energy the next day and assisted individuals go to sleep faster.

Melatonin is likewise helpful when traveling and getting used to a brand-new time zone, as it helps your body's body clock go back to regular (). In some nations, you require a prescription for melatonin. In others, melatonin is widely readily available in stores or online.

Start with a low dosage to evaluate your tolerance and then increase it gradually as needed. Since melatonin might change brain chemistry, it's recommended that you contact a doctor prior to usage. You ought to likewise speak with them if you're thinking of using melatonin as a sleep aid for your kid, as long-term use of this supplement in children has actually not been well studied.

An underlying health condition may be the cause of your sleep problems. One common problem is sleep apnea, which triggers inconsistent and cut off breathing. People with this condition stop breathing repeatedly while sleeping (, ). This condition may be more common than you believe. One evaluation claimed that 24% of men and 9% of ladies have sleep apnea ().

If you've always fought with sleep, it might be a good idea to consult your doctor. There are lots of typical conditions that can cause bad sleep, including sleep apnea. Routine exercise during daytime hours is one of the finest methods to ensure an excellent night's sleep.Nocturia is the medical term for extreme urination during the night. It affects sleep quality and daytime energy(,). Drinking large quantities of liquids before bed can cause similar symptoms, though some people are more delicate than others. Try to not consume any fluids 12 hours before going to bed.

You must likewise use the restroom right prior to going to bed, as this might decrease your chances of waking in the night. Reduce fluid consumption in the late evening and attempt to utilize the bathroom right before bed. Do you need to get much better sleep? A comfortable mattress and pillows are important for great sleep, but whether they're soft or firm is up to you. The pillow you choose might depend on your favored sleep position. If you're a side sleeper(as the majority of people are ), your pillow needs to conveniently support your head, neck, and ear in addition to your shoulder. If your bed feels dreamy however your space is a mess, you could be at a greater danger for sleep issues. A research study presented at the June 2015 SLEEP conference in Seattle recommends that those surrounded by mess were most likely to have a sleep condition. What your eyes see when you stroll into a room can influence whether you'll have an easy time dropping off to sleep. Rather of switching on an intense overhead light, think of lights, a dimmer switch, or candles to develop a more peaceful setting. In addition to being more low profile, indirect light is less disruptive the body's natural circadian rhythms. Part of the winding down process in the evening in fact begins throughout the day. If you take a snooze for too long or too late in the day, it can throw off your sleep schedule and make it harder to get to sleep when you want to. The very best time to nap is shortly after lunch in the early afternoon, and the very best nap length is around 20 minutes. Altering these habits can require time, but the effort can pay off by making you more relaxed and ready to drop off to sleep when bedtime rolls around. As much as possible, try to create a constant regimen that you follow each night because this.



assists reinforce healthy habits and signals to body and mind that bedtime is approaching. Do Not Stew in Bed: You wish to avoid a connection in your mind in between your bed and frustration from sleeplessness. This implies that if you have actually invested around 20 minutes in bed without having the ability to fall asleep, get out of bed and do something relaxing in low light. Avoid inspecting the time during this time. Try Out Various Methods: Sleeping problems can be intricate and what works for a single person may not work for someone else. As a result, it makes sense to try various approaches to see what works for you. Simply keep in mind that it can spend some time for new methods to take result, so provide your modifications time to begin prior to assuming that they aren't working for you.
